  • 2/5 Priscilla P. 1 year ago on Google
    If you want a sweet ice latte served in a cute aesthetic this is a perfect spot for you. If you are into specialty coffee, it is not. I really wanted to like this place but unfortunately the barista had no idea what they were doing. I don't think this is the fault of the barista, I think they're needs to be better training regarding coffee preparation and knowledge. Ordered a cortado and received an 8oz drink of espresso, warm milk, and a bunch of sugar. I asked to exchange it for a cappuccino and received an over-aerated drink that was extremely hot and ended up burning my tongue. After cooling is it very obvious the esspresso has not been dialed in. Both drinks were served in to-go cups as there is no option for ceramic. I also find it odd for a specialty coffee roaster to not disclose their coffee's place of origin. I would really only recommend this place for ice drinks and pastries.
